3. The House of Santa in Porta Venezia

Babbo_Natale_Indro_Montanelli
La casa di Babbo Natale is open from 6 until 25 December 2015.
Opening hours: on working days, until 22 December, open from 2.30 until 6pm. Every Sunday and working days after 20 December open 10am until 12.30 and from 2.30 until 6pm.
People can also visit the related Christmas market (more).
NOTE: Starting from 30 December and until 6 January 2016 the Befana’s house will be open from 10.30am until 12.30 and from 2.30pm until 6pm for children, who will have the chance to take a picture with her and fill their socks with candies – as prescribed by the Italian tradition.
